Latest Patents

Hideki Osaka holds a patent for a lubricating oil specifically designed for refrigerators. This lubricating oil utilizes 1,1,1,2-tetrafluoroethane refrigerant as its base. The oil is formulated with esters, which provide a viscosity range of 2-30 mm/s at 100°C. By adjusting the viscosity through the addition of esters or polymers, the lubricating oil is tailored to meet the requirements of various refrigerator types. This innovative oil exhibits excellent compatibility with the refrigerant, low hygroscopic properties, and high heat resistance. Furthermore, it maintains corrosion resistance and insulating properties while achieving high refrigerant stability and hydrolytic stability. The inclusion of a sulfur-type anti-wear agent enhances the oil's performance on iron and aluminum contact surfaces within the refrigerator.
